Discuz数据库备份存储位置详解
discuz备份数据库位置

首页 2025-04-05 05:36:27



Discuz备份数据库位置:确保数据安全的关键步骤 在当今数字化时代,网站已成为企业、个人展示信息、提供服务的重要平台

    而Discuz,作为一款功能强大、易于使用的社区管理系统,深受广大网站管理员的喜爱

    然而,无论多么出色的系统,数据安全始终是其稳定运行的基础

    其中,数据库备份作为数据安全的重要组成部分,其位置的选择与管理显得尤为重要

    本文将深入探讨Discuz备份数据库的位置选择、备份策略以及实际操作,旨在帮助管理员确保数据万无一失

     一、Discuz数据库备份的重要性 在正式讨论备份位置之前,我们首先要明确数据库备份的重要性

    数据库是Discuz系统的核心,存储了用户信息、帖子内容、系统设置等关键数据

    一旦数据库遭遇损坏、被恶意攻击或误操作导致数据丢失,将对整个社区造成不可估量的损失

    因此,定期进行数据库备份,确保数据可恢复性,是每一位Discuz管理员的基本职责

     二、Discuz备份数据库位置的选择原则 1.安全性 备份文件存储位置的首要原则是安全性

    这意味着备份文件应存放在不易被外部攻击者访问的位置,同时防止内部人员未经授权的访问

    通常,备份文件不应直接存放在Web服务器的根目录下,而应放置在一个受限制访问的目录中,或者通过网络存储解决方案(如NAS、云存储)进行安全存储

     2.可靠性 备份位置的可靠性同样关键

    选择的存储介质应具备较高的容错能力,避免因硬件故障导致备份数据丢失

    对于本地存储,可以考虑使用RAID(独立磁盘冗余阵列)技术来提高数据冗余性

    而对于远程存储,则应选择信誉良好、服务稳定的云服务提供商

     3.便捷性 虽然安全性和可靠性至关重要,但便捷性也不容忽视

    备份位置应便于管理员进行定期检查和恢复操作

    这意味着备份文件应存放在一个易于访问但又受保护的位置,同时备份和恢复流程应尽可能自动化,以减少人为错误和提高效率

     三、Discuz数据库备份的具体位置与操作 1.本地备份 - 服务器本地目录:最常见的备份位置之一是服务器上的特定目录

    管理员可以创建一个专门的备份文件夹,设置合适的权限,确保只有授权用户才能访问

    通过Discuz自带的备份工具或命令行工具(如mysqldump),定期将数据库导出为SQL文件存放在此文件夹中

     - 外接存储设备:对于对数据安全性有更高要求的管理员,可以考虑使用外接硬盘、USB闪存盘等物理设备进行备份

    这种方式虽然操作稍显繁琐,但提供了额外的数据隔离层,降低了被网络攻击的风险

     2.远程备份 - 云存储服务:随着云计算的普及,越来越多的管理员选择将备份文件上传至云存储服务,如阿里云OSS、腾讯云COS等

    这些服务不仅提供了高可用性和容灾能力,还允许管理员通过API进行自动化备份管理,大大提高了备份效率和灵活性

     - FTP/SFTP服务器:对于希望保持一定控制权的管理员,可以将备份文件通过FTP或SFTP协议传输至远程服务器

    这种方式虽然需要配置网络连接和访问权限,但为备份数据提供了额外的物理隔离层

     3.数据库自带的备份功能 部分数据库管理系统(如MySQL)提供了内置的备份工具,如mysqldump,可以直接在命令行中执行备份操作

    管理员可以编写脚本,结合cron作业(Linux系统)或任务计划程序(Windows系统),实现定时自动备份,并将备份文件保存到指定的本地或远程位置

     四、备份策略与最佳实践 1.定期备份 制定并执行定期备份计划是基础

    根据网站的重要性和数据变化频率,确定每日、每周或每月的备份频率

    同时,考虑到数据恢复的时间窗口,保留多个版本的备份文件,以便在必要时能够恢复到特定的时间点

     2.差异备份与全量备份 为了平衡备份效率和存储空间,可以结合使用差异备份和全量备份

    全量备份包含数据库的所有数据,而差异备份仅记录自上次全量备份以来发生变化的数据

    这种方式可以显著减少备份文件的大小和备份时间

     3.备份验证 备份完成后,务必进行备份验证,确保备份文件完整且可恢复

    这可以通过尝试在测试环境中恢复备份文件来完成,验证数据的完整性和应用程序的兼容性

     4.加密与压缩 为了提高备份文件的安全性和传输效率,可以对备份文件进行加密和压缩

    加密可以防止备份数据在传输或存储过程中被窃取,而压缩则可以减少存储空间占用和传输时间

     五、总结 Discuz备份数据库位置的选择与管理是确保数据安全的关键步骤

    通过遵循安全性、可靠性和便捷性的原则,管理员可以制定出适合自己网站的备份策略

    无论是本地备份还是远程备份,关键在于选择合适的存储位置,结合高效的备份工具和方法,确保数据在任何情况下都能迅速恢复

    同时,定期的备份验证、合理的备份策略以及备份文件的加密与压缩,将进一步巩固数据安全的防线

    在这个数字化时代,让我们共同努力,守护好每一份珍贵的数据

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道